MJ shares her experience of working for a nonprofit organization and the unexpected turn her career took. Originally hired to help small businesses, she was reassigned to a program that built houses for first-time homebuyers. MJ recounts a memorable incident when her boss was arrested while they were driving to an award ceremony. She navigates the aftermath of the arrest, takes on the role of housing director, and learns about the housing industry. Despite the challenges, MJ excels in her new position, until...

Quotes:

• "I know nothing about birthing no babies or building no houses."

• "I'm a fish out of water or in some new water that I didn't know I was getting into."

• "I'm up for the challenge, and I've already quit my job. So what am I going to do, say no at this point?"
